My dog has bloody diarrhea and chewed a cord. Should I worry?

Updated On September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Dog | Border Collie | Male | neutered | 1 year and 3 months old | 50 lbs

Loki has a tiny bit of fresh looking blood on the hairs around his anus. He's not out of his ordinary self or anything he's just a tad more cuddly at the moment. He has had a case of the runs for a few days now and I've only just noticed the blood today. He has also chewed up an Internet cord on Saturday night (he did it because I was away and he wanted me to be with him and not my mother) haha He looks a bit irritated by his bum at the moment but that's all.

If Loki is having diarrhea with some blood in it, I would recommend a veterinary visit. Depending on the amount of court he swallowed he could develop a G.I. obstruction or perforation. But diarrhea with blood in it can be an indication of parasites, severe G.I. disease, pancreatitis, or viral infection. I would recommend a veterinary visit to assess why he has the diarrhea so it can be treated appropriately.
